SCHOOL SPORTS

CRICKET MATCHES ® WEI AKAT AX E v. O EOTI K L A cricket match for the Baker Challenge Cup was played between Opotiki and AYhakatane High Schools on Saturday and resulted in an easy win for the latter by an innings and (15 runs. Opotiki in the first innings made 57 runs, Hedlov with EG being the top scorer, and in the second innings made 76 runs,’ Ktirurangi making three successive sixes. Whakatane made 198 runs in the first innings, Keepa making 101 runs. Tiie results were : OPOTIKI First Innings. Medley c. and b. Keepa 1G .Redpath c. Scrivener b. Raymond 0 Brown b.
